#adaffe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#adaffe is composed of 67.8% red, 68.6%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.9% cyan, 31.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 238.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 83.7%. #adaffe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5b5ffd.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#adaffe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#adaffe has RGB values of R:173, G:175,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 11382782.

Hex triplet adaffe #adaffe
RGB Decimal 173, 175, 254 rgb(173,175,254)
RGB Percent 67.8, 68.6, 99.6 rgb(67.8%,68.6%,99.6%)
CMYK 32, 31, 0, 0
HSL 238.5°, 97.6, 83.7 hsl(238.5,97.6%,83.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 238.5°, 31.9, 99.6
Web Safe 9999ff #9999ff
CIE-LAB 73.997, 16.916, -39.314
XYZ 50.449, 46.699, 100.116
xyY 0.256, 0.237, 46.699
CIE-LCH 73.997, 42.799, 293.281
CIE-LUV 73.997, -5.662, -65.94
Hunter-Lab 68.337, 12.188, -39.027
Binary 10101101, 10101111, 11111110

Shades and Tints of #adaffe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00010f is the darkest color, while #fbfbff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#adaffe is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b7b7b7 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b5b5c5 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a1b7ff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a0b7fc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a3bdcb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a5b4fe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#a5b4fc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a7b8dd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
